> On Jan 23, 2015, at 04:16 PM, Brett Cannon wrote: > > >Looks like my id_rsa key is not being tried soon enough for the > two-attempt > >threshold as the key that GitHub for Mac installed and my work key are > >being tried first (I tried specifying my id_rsa key with -i but that > didn't > >seem to change anything): > > I get this all the time when I add my Debian ssh key to ssh-agent and then > try > to connect to hosts on my LAN (which use a different key). I think this > is a > limitation of ssh-agent and if you search the web, you'll find various > solutions, which I've used to varying degrees of success. > > Basically you want to force ssh not to use the agent when connecting to the > site (I haven't yet tried hg.python.org with multiple keys). E.g. in your > ~/.ssh/config file: > > Host hg.python.org > IdentityFile ~/.ssh/id_rsa > IdentitiesOnly yes > > HTH, > -Barry > _______________________________________________ > python-committers mailing list > [email protected] > https://mail.python.org/mailman/listinfo/python-committers >
